Nepal Certifying Company and NIC Asia Reach a Deal

NIC Asia is the only bank who has fully accepted the paper-less banking concept in Nepal, who now has joined their hands with Nepal Certifying Company (NCC) to acquire Digital Signature Certificate (DSC).

Biplav Man Singh, Chairman, NCC said, “We are glad that we are going to provide our DSC service to NIC Asia. I hope this agreement will surely increase the awareness and will for other financial institutions to implement DSC for carrying out their businesses”. Radiant Infotech Nepal has been authorized to issue these certificates while Nepal Certifying Company would managing once they are published.

Laxman Rijal, Acting CEO, NIC Asia said, “We believe that implementing DSC service can provide our customers with safe and secure services.”
